Jianghaui Auto to sell 700 mln yuan 365-day bills
(chinatrucks.com, Jan.19, 2010)Anhui Jianghuai Automobile Co. Ltd. (JAC) (600418) recently announced that it will issue 700 million yuan ($102.5 million) in 365-day financial bills on the interbank market on January 22, media reported.
The Chinese vehicle manufacturer said that this batch of bills will be issued at par value 100 yuan with the issuing rate to be decided by results of bookkeeping underwriter Industrial & Commercial Bank of China.
The value date is Jan. 25, 2010; payment date Jan. 25, 2010; circulation date Jan. 26, 2010; maturity date Jan. 25, 2011. Issuing the short-term bills is expected to help Jianghuai speed up its ambitious plans for a huge jump in this year's vehicle output and sales.
Jianghuai sold 100,000 passenger cars in the Jan-Oct period, two months ahead of its original plan. The full-year sales exceeded 120,000 units, almost double last year's sales. It also sold more than 180,000 commercial vehicles in 2009.
The company aims to sell 500,000 vehicles this year, including 300,000 passenger cars and 200,000 commercial vehicles.
